Fix the ASN1 sanity check: correct header length

calculation and check overflow against LONG_MAX.

Changes between 0.9.6e and 0.9.6f [XX xxx XXXX] Changes between 0.9.6e and 0.9.6f [XX xxx XXXX]
*) Fix ASN1 checks. Check for overflow by comparing with LONG_MAX
and get fix the header length calculation.
[Florian Weimer <Weimer@CERT.Uni-Stuttgart.DE>,
Alon Kantor <alonk@checkpoint.com> (and others),
Steve Henson]
*) Use proper error handling instead of 'assertions' in buffer *) Use proper error handling instead of 'assertions' in buffer
overflow checks added in 0.9.6e. This prevents DoS (the overflow checks added in 0.9.6e. This prevents DoS (the
assertions could call abort()). assertions could call abort()).
